Prices are on the up.

Rough cars aren't as cheap as what they used to be, but then scrap prices aren't what they used to be either. Supply of rough cars is slowing, but I suspect there will be a boost of them soon when many owners can't be bothered with big welding bills for MOT.

Really good clean cared for cars do seem to have a bit of a market, but there is still a skew towards top spec cars rather than the mid to lower spec cars. WHM have had that 40K black TCT for sale for a long time now, and I don't think the price is too unreasonable for what it is either.
